Hey folks, I have a Silver Sun Blade 2500 which shows a strange problem: I always power it off by using "shutdown -r" and then at the OF prompt use power-off. If I do shutdown -p instead, the NVRAM gets "corrupted" somehow. On next power up the machine will fail like this: @(#)OBP 4.30.4.a 2010/01/06 14:47 Sun Blade 2500 (Silver) Clearing TLBs Loading Configuration Membase: 0000.0013.0000.0000 MemSize: 0000.0000.4000.0000 Init CPU arrays Done Init E$ tags Done Setup TLB Done MMUs ON Scrubbing Tomatillo tags... 0 1 Block Scrubbing Done Find dropin, Copying Done, Size 0000.0000.0000.8330 PC = 0000.07ff.f000.7248 PC = 0000.0000.0000.72f8 Find dropin, (copied), Decompressing Done, Size 0000.0000.0006.8ad0 Diagnostic console initialized System Reset: CPU Reset Probing system devices jbus at 0,0 SUNW,UltraSPARC-IIIi (1600 MHz @ 10:1, 1 MB) memory-controller jbus at 1,0 SUNW,UltraSPARC-IIIi (1600 MHz @ 10:1, 1 MB) memory-controller jbus at 1c,0 pci ppm jbus at 1d,0 pci jbus at 1e,0 pci ppm jbus at 1f,0 pci i2c /i2c@1f,464000: nvram idprom Loading Support Packages: kbd-translator obp-tftp SUNW,i2c-ram-device SUNW,fru-device SUNW,asr Loading onboard drivers: /pci@1e,600000: Device 7 isa /pci@1e,600000/isa@7: flashprom rtc i2c power serial serial dma /pci@1e,600000/isa@7/i2c@0,320: i2c-bridge gpio hardware-monitor hardware-monitor hardware-monitor gpio gpio audio-card-fru-prom motherboard-fru-prom scsi-backplane-fru-prom dimm-spd dimm-spd dimm-spd dimm-spd dimm-spd dimm-spd dimm-spd dimm-spd clock-generator /pci@1e,600000/isa@7/dma@0,0: parallel ERROR: Last Trap: Fast Data Access MMU Miss debug: The "debug:" prompt is just a restricted version of the "ok" prompt, but booting is disabled. A "set defaults" does not fix it, but after some playing around with NVRAM values, setting things back and forth (details of which I unfortunately did not log) the machine worked again - and then I restored all settings to normal. This machine does not have the typical combined clock/nvram chip, but uses an extra Atmel 24C64B serial EEPPROM (mounted in a "holder" to allow easy replacement and hidden below a Sun host ID label, but stock PL27 package inside). First time through I actually thought this chip would be dead and got an (empty) replacement, which imediately fixed the issue. So my theory is that somehow the kernel call into OF to do the poweroff messes up some parts of the eeprom content, which "set defaults" does not cover. Or something. Maybe I should try to get access to that chip from some other device and dump full content, with working and non-working versions and cmpare. However, since we call OF to do the power-off, why does it work from the ok prompt, but not from within the NetBSD kernel? I don't feel happy trying this a lot ;-) Does anyone see something similar?
